Within the framework of finite temperature field theory this paper discusses the shear viscosity of hot QED plasma through Kubo formula at one-loop skeleton diagram level with a finite chemical potential. The effective widths(damping rates) are introduced to regulate the pinch singularities. The finite chemical potential, which enhances the contributions to the shear viscosity from the electrons while suppresses those from the photons, finally gives a positive contribution compared to the pure temperature environment. The result agrees with that from the kinetics theory qualitatively.
